Output d3220608b26a5aaf3fde587675e22e6f425f53ccbd9baa99ff1669e3971a8c79:1

value
17308176
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ba1b12439d7250980a2d8139225aa22f95c69a0b OP_EQUALVERIFY OP_CHECKSIG
address
1Hy37dZmT9ynebEC1djPWmYbhGiYZ5QHPT
transaction
d3220608b26a5aaf3fde587675e22e6f425f53ccbd9baa99ff1669e3971a8c79
spent
false

3 Sat Ranges